Report: Optimism that Kyle Van Noy will play on Sunday

Ravens linebacker Kyle Van Noy returned to practice on Friday and looks like he has a good chance of playing against the Raiders on Sunday.

Ian Rapoport of NFL Media reports that Van Noy is optimistic about playing in the game. Van Noy suffered an orbital fracture in his team's season-opening loss to the Chiefs.

Van Noy complained about receiving “super unprofessional” Treatment by the Chiefs medical staff at Arrowhead Stadium and NFLPA Executive Director Lloyd Howell also expressed the need for a better answer, but the Chiefs said they believe They acted responsibly in the wake of Van Noy's injury.

The Ravens listed Van Noy as questionable on their final injury report of the week. Cornerback Nate Wiggins was ruled out with a neck injury and a concussion suffered in a car accident, and linebacker Adisa Isaac (hamstring) is questionable.
